What is a day shift stationary engineer?

Day Shift Stationary Engineers are professionals who operate and maintain stationary engines, boilers, and other mechanical equipment during daytime hours in facilities such as factories, hospitals, and office buildings. Their primary duties include monitoring equipment to ensure safe and efficient operation, performing preventative maintenance, and making necessary repairs. They also keep detailed records of equipment performance and may be responsible for adhering to safety and environmental regulations. Working the day shift typically means their work hours are during standard business hours, allowing them to interact with other facility staff and management.

What skills and qualifications are needed to be a day shift stationary engineer?

To thrive as a Day Shift Stationary Engineer, you need a strong understanding of mechanical systems, boilers, HVAC, and a high school diploma or equivalent, often supplemented by a stationary engineer license. Familiarity with building automation systems, control panels, and preventive maintenance software is typically required. Effective problem-solving, attention to detail, and strong communication skills help in diagnosing issues and coordinating with other facility staff. These competencies are crucial for ensuring safe, efficient, and uninterrupted operation of building systems during daily shifts.

What are common challenges faced by day shift stationary engineers, and how can they be addressed?

Day Shift Stationary Engineers often encounter challenges such as troubleshooting unexpected equipment malfunctions, managing time effectively during routine inspections, and responding to urgent maintenance needs. To address these, it's important to maintain strong technical knowledge, regularly review system manuals, and communicate proactively with team members and supervisors. Staying organized and documenting issues can also help ensure a smooth workflow and minimize downtime during critical situations.

Northwest Hospital is seeking a licensed First Grade Stationary Engineer to join our daytime engineering operations team. This is not a back-of-house, isolated boiler room role. This position is forward-facing, highly collaborative, and essential to hospital operations.
You'll play a critical role in keeping our utilities infrastructure safe, reliable, and operating at peak performance in a busy acute care hospital environment.
What You'll Do
  • Conduct daily inspections of boilers, chillers, pumps, air handlers, and associated utility systems
  • Monitor, log, and trend equipment readings to proactively prevent failures
  • Perform preventive and corrective maintenance on plant equipment
  • Troubleshoot and respond to operational issues quickly and effectively
  • Collaborate with maintenance technicians, leadership, and clinical teams to resolve issues
  • Maintain accurate documentation to support regulatory compliance and operational excellence

What Makes This Role Different
  • Day shift schedule - 6:00 AM to 2:00 PM
  • Modern, well-maintained central plant
  • Direct impact on patient care and hospital operations
  • Strong team culture with collaboration across departments
  • Competitive compensation and internal advancement opportunity

What We're Looking For
  • Maryland First Grade Stationary Engineer's License (required)
  • 5+ years of central plant or hospital utilities experience
  • Strong troubleshooting ability and attention to detail
  • Professional presence with the ability to interact with patients, staff, and leadership
  • High energy, customer-focused mindset
